Beaufort County: Beaufort County’s Battery Creek Pool to Close for Repairs Monday, November 29
0Comments

Beaufort County issued the following announcement on November 22.

Beaufort County’s Parks and Recreation Department announced that Battery Creek Pool will close for repairs and resurfacing. The pool will close beginning Monday, November 29 and is not scheduled to reopen until after January 1, 2022.

County residents will be able to swim five days a week at Beaufort Pool, located on Youmans Drive behind Beaufort High School (map). The amended hours of operation at Beaufort Pool will be Monday through Friday, 8 a.m. to 12 p.m. and 1 p.m. to 7 p.m.

Once Battery Creek Pool reopens, it is anticipated both pools will return to their regular hours of operation. 

For questions and more information, call Beaufort County Parks and Recreation Department at 843-255-6710.
